How to mix seasonal accessories creatively to refresh outfits and extend the perceived range of a compact wardrobe.
A quick guide to pairing scarves, belts, jewelry, hats, and bags so you can refresh outfits across seasons even with a small closet without spending beyond your existing staples.

Seasoning your wardrobe with seasonal accessories is a smart, practical habit. Accessories act as color amplifiers, textural shifts, and visual cues that redefine basic garments. Begin by auditing the pieces you already own, sorting them into cores and accents. Core items stay constant; accents rotate with the calendar. Consider the stories your colors tell: cool blues and greens feel calm in spring, while warm ambers and coppers glow in autumn. By placing emphasis on a few reliable staples and a handful of flexible accents, you can craft dozens of distinct looks from a limited roster. This mindset keeps your style coherent yet endlessly fresh, season after season.
The key to perpetual refreshment is thoughtful proportion and placement. Small accessories often yield big impact when you vary their scale and position. Try a slender belt over a tucked top to redefine your waistline, then switch to a broader belt over a loose cardigan for a different silhouette. Layer necklaces with varied lengths to introduce depth, or mix metals to convey a deliberate, modern edge. A brimmed hat can frame your face and pull an outfit together without requiring new garments. Even the simplest bag can set the tone, transforming a monochrome outfit into something polished and intentional.
A thoughtful rotation can stretch a small wardrobe beyond its size.
When you rotate accessories thoughtfully, you unlock new aesthetic opportunities without increasing clutter. Start by mapping your mood to color and texture, then select items that reinforce that intention. A pop of metallic shine can elevate a matte fabric, while a matte finish softens a gleaming surface. Texture contrast is your friend: pair smooth leather with a wool scarf, or a velvet bag against a denim jacket for tactile intrigue. Consider the context—work, weekend, evening—and align your choices with that tempo. This approach maintains consistency while honoring personal expression, helping you feel prepared for any social scenario.

Practical experimentation yields dependable results over time. Keep a small, visible rotation of accessories where you can see them daily, and remove anything that feels redundant after a week. Document combinations that worked and those that didn’t, then refine your capsule with intentional swaps. For instance, if you notice a metallic necklace elevates casual denim, preserve that pairing while replacing a neutral belt with one in a bolder hue. The goal is discernment: choose items that multiply your outfit options, not merely fill space. Over months, you’ll assemble a flexible toolkit that adapts to changing trends while staying true to your style.
Mixing metals and textures creates dynamic, modern outfits.
Seasonal accessories thrive on selective repetition and clever pairing. The tactic is to reuse key pieces in new contexts, creating the illusion of variety. A scarf can become a pocket square in a blazer, a headband in the hair, or a shawl draped over a coat for warmth without bulk. Belts can cinch different garments to reveal varied proportions, while scarves and jewelry can echo color across layers. Choose patterns and textures that complement multiple fabrics so the same item feels fresh in each outfit. By planning cross‑category compatibility, you minimize waste while maximizing impact across your daily wardrobe.

Consider the footwear as a connective actor in your accessory ensemble. Shoes color, finish, and height influence perceived formality and season. A suede ankle boot pairs beautifully with a midi dress in one season and with cropped pants in another, thanks to its forgiving texture. Replace or reframe a bag by shifting its size or handle style—convert a tote into a shoulder bag with a simple strap swap. By treating footwear and bags as adaptable connectors, you gain more outfit permutations from fewer pieces. This mindset keeps your closet lean yet expressive, ready for spontaneous styling choices.
Strategic use of color and finish keeps outfits energized.
Mixing metals is not a rule so much as a playful invitation. Pair warm golds with cool silvers to achieve a balanced glow that suits daytime errands or evening events. Introduce mixed textures, such as a smooth leather belt with a textured knit, to create visual interest without shouting. A delicate bracelet can be layered with a chunkier cuff, maintaining a refined, intentional vibe. If you favor monochrome palettes, metallic accents become the punctuation marks that prevent the outfit from feeling flat. The objective is harmony, not uniformity, so allow contrast to guide your decisions and your confidence to grow with each combination.
Accessory coordination should feel effortless, not engineered. Build a small library of go‑to mixes you actually enjoy wearing, and keep it visible in your wardrobe area. Try a three‑item rule: one bold statement piece, one classic staple, and one versatile neutral. This trio can be recombined across outfits, creating a surprisingly broad range with minimal effort. Don’t hesitate to test unexpected pairings, such as a warm scarf with a cool metallic bag, or a structured hat with a casual tee. The aim is to cultivate intuition, so you instinctively pick items that sing together without overthinking.

Color is the quickest route to perceived novelty. Rather than adding new garments, introduce seasonal hues through accessories that pick up or echo tones already in your most-worn pieces. A scarf can pick up the blue of a favorite cardigan, while a belt can intensify a burst of autumnal orange in a blouse. If you stick with a cohesive base palette—neutrals with one or two accent colors—your accessories can lead the eye and transport you to a fresh mood. The beauty lies in consistency sprinkled with novelty, so color becomes an anchor rather than a gamble.
Finish and polish stem from thoughtful coordination, not from buying more. A simple routine—check what you have, plan outfits for the week, and rotate three accessories per day—keeps your wardrobe from stagnating. Consider light refits: rethread a necklace, restring a bracelet, or swap a watch strap to alter its vibe. Small maintenance steps can make older pieces feel new again, which reduces waste and supports mindful consumption. The more deliberate your approach, the more routine becomes a source of confidence, and the less you rely on impulse shopping to feel current.
A compact wardrobe grows in range when you treat accessories as a recurring design language. Start with a limited set of proven champions and rotate others to test new combinations. Keep a simple plan: what to wear with what, when to swap, and which items to spotlight on busy days. Your goal is consistency with evolving detail, so you appear cohesive yet flexible. The right accessories will bridge gaps between items, smoothing transitions from day to night and from work to weekend. By embracing routine experimentation, you cultivate a personal signature that remains resilient across trends and seasons.
Finally, cultivate a mindful shopping mindset that respects your established system. When you introduce new pieces, assess how they integrate with existing accents and silhouettes. Favor versatile shapes, high‑quality finishes, and colors you already enjoy wearing. Seasonal alignment matters—choose accents that echo current weather and light—so they feel appropriate rather than gratuitous. A well‑curated, adaptable accessory set offers fresh possibilities without clutter, helping you maintain a compact wardrobe that looks expansive, polished, and consciously curated year after year.
